View Single Post
  #3  
Old May 22nd, 2004, 08:50 PM
Esben Mose Hansen's Avatar

Esben Mose Hansen Esben Mose Hansen is offline
Second Lieutenant
 
Join Date: Jan 2004
Location: Copenhagen, Denmark
Posts: 410
Thanks: 0
Thanked 0 Times in 0 Posts
Esben Mose Hansen is on a distinguished road
Default Re: New & raw web based Dominion II game server

The abysia.2h file is my fault. It was there until I accidentially deleted it when creating the zip file. Looking through the log file I see 2 strange things, speaking like any Monty fan:

1. The game reports a CD violation?! (Jotunheim, I believe it was)

2. My server scripts had apparantly crashed a number of times. I have since changed the code a bit, so it should be more defensive now. Still, it had been restarted a lot since crashing.

3. There is a known bug which I don't know how to solve. The socket lingers (in TIMEWAIT2, I presume) when the server is killed, which means that the program cannot be restartet before an interval has passed. And the perl script cannot access information on this level. I'm planning on reading up on sudo to solve this problem, though. In practice this means that you HAVE TO CHECK whether the server really restartet. It may state that it was a success, but a reload of the page will reveal that the server instantly crashed. Just restart the server again, and all will be fine.
__________________
"It makes you wonder if there is anything to astrology after all. "Oh, there is," said Susan, "Delusion, wishful thinking and gullibility." (T. Pratchett)